Jeremiah 29:11 says, “For I know the plans I have for you,” declares the Lord, “plans to prosper you and not to harm you, plans to give you hope and a future.

I heard a beautiful analogy today, it was used in a different context but it works to describe what I want to share with you today. So here’s my version of it, “Life is like a ballroom dance. There is always one who leads and one who is being led.” In your dance are you the one doing the leading or are you the one being led?

Jeremiah 29:11 tells us that God knows the plans He has for us. They are good plans. Great plans.  1 Corinthians 2:9 gives us insight into these plans and it says, “This is why the Scriptures say: Things never discovered or heard of before, things beyond our ability to imagine — these are the many things God has in storefor all his lovers.

God promises that He has plans to give us hope and a future. Not just any future, a beautiful and bright future. We cannot begin to imagine the future that God has planned for us. It’s beyond words and beyond our wildest imagination. I can tell you now that 10 years ago I could not see myself where I am today. I always get excited thinking about the future because I know that for as long as God is in my life, my future is good. Likewise for you, as long as God is in it, your future is looking real good!

Isaiah 55:8-9 says, ““My thoughts are nothing like your thoughts,” says the Lord.“And my ways are far beyond anything you could imagine. For just as the heavens are higher than the earth, so my ways are higher than your ways and my thoughts higher than your thoughts.” 

Unless God reveals something to us, we cannot fathom the plans He has for us because we don’t think the way He thinks. Yet, whenever presented with an opportunity we try to take lead. We try to lead the dance, lead our lives in the direction we think is best. But we can barely see what’s in front of us let alone what the future holds. And our verse today tells us that God knows the plans, not us. Even when He reveals things to us, He does not give us the full breakdown with dates and times and every last detail of how we are going to get there. Most of those details form part of the adventure. 

A couple weeks ago we talked about how God is good. We need to trust God with our lives. Trust Him with our futures and trust Him to execute His plans in our lives. We have a relationship with God. We are not just mindless zombies following Him because we have no choice. We choose daily to follow Christ and to lay down our own opinions and what we think should happen and we trade that for His plans which we know will be greater than our wildest dreams!

God is good. Because He is good, we do not need to concern ourselves with leading the dance. Instead, we can allow ourselves to be swept off our feet and led by the One who loves us and gave His life for us. God knows the plans. Trust Him with His plans. He knows what He is doing. He knows the song, the timing and flow. Let Him do the leading.
